With a <strong>current asking price of $437,000<\/strong>, this home has been on the market for 10 days, and is neither bank-owned nor a short sale.  It sits between the Loyal Heights Playfield and Salmon Bay Park in the north end of <a href=\"http:\/\/www.redfin.com\/neighborhood\/121\/WA\/Seattle\/Ballard\" title=\"Ballard stats\">Ballard<\/a>, where the median sale price of single-family homes in October was $388,000.<\/p>\n<p>Built shortly after the second world war in 1946, this 1-story home (with basement) has 3 bedrooms and 1.75 bathrooms.  <a href=\"http:\/\/info.kingcounty.gov\/Assessor\/eRealProperty\/Detail.aspx?ParcelNbr=7518503095\" title=\"Parcel data for 751850-3095\">According to King County records<\/a>, 880 of the home&#8217;s total 1,380 finished square feet are above-ground, with an additional 500 in the basement.  There is also a 1-car garage in the basement.  The listing agent claims that the home&#8217;s architectural style is &#8220;Cape Cod,&#8221; but it doesn&#8217;t look like <a href=\"https:\/\/www.google.com\/search?q=Cape%20Cod%20revival&#038;tbm=isch\" title=\"Google Image Search: Cape Cod revival\">any Cape Cod home I&#8217;ve ever seen<\/a>.<\/p>\n<div style=\"clear:both;\"><\/div>\n<p><a href=\"http:\/\/www.redfin.com\/WA\/Seattle\/7310-19th-Ave-NW-98117\/home\/165080\" title=\"7310 19th Ave NW Seattle, WA 98117 Seattle, WA 98112\"><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" src=\"http:\/\/seattlebubble.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2011\/11\/7310-19th-Ave-NW-02sm.jpg\" title=\"7310 19th Ave NW Seattle, WA 98117\" alt=\"7310 19th Ave NW Seattle, WA 98117\" style=\"border:1px solid #000000; float:left; margin:0 10px 0 0;\" width=\"300\" height=\"200\" \/><\/a>At 4,080 square feet, this home&#8217;s lot is slightly smaller than the 5,100 square foot lot that seems to dominate the neighborhood.  The house sits up quite a bit from the street, with nicely-landscaped terraces on either side of the ~25-step staircase that leads to the front door.  Despite the home&#8217;s elevation above the street, there is no view to speak of.<\/p>\n<p>Inside, you&#8217;ve got your typical hardwood floors throughout the first floor (save for the kitchen).  The bedrooms are nicely laid out, though they do feel a bit small.  Some of the electrical appears to be dated, with numerous ungrounded outlets appearing around the home.  The living room has a wood fireplace, while the basement den sports a gas fireplace.  The bedroom in the basement has only one small window near the ceiling (seen in the photo at left).  The ceilings in the basement are about seven feet tall.<\/p>\n<div style=\"clear:both;\"><\/div>\n<p><a href=\"http:\/\/www.redfin.com\/WA\/Seattle\/7310-19th-Ave-NW-98117\/home\/165080\" title=\"7310 19th Ave NW Seattle, WA 98117 Seattle, WA 98112\"><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" src=\"http:\/\/seattlebubble.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2011\/11\/7310-19th-Ave-NW-03sm.jpg\" title=\"7310 19th Ave NW Seattle, WA 98117\" alt=\"7310 19th Ave NW Seattle, WA 98117\" style=\"border:1px solid #000000; float:right; margin:0 0 0 10px;\" width=\"300\" height=\"200\" \/><\/a>In a refreshing deviation from the bubble days, the kitchen counters are <em>not<\/em> granite, but are tiled instead.  The cabinets are dated, but functional.  There is no dining room, just a small extended area off the back of the kitchen, large enough for a small four-person table.  There is a good-sized garden window off the kitchen&#8217;s dining area.<\/p>\n<p>The back yard is small, but functional, with a few small raised garden beds and a sandbox.  The brick patio is easily large enough for entertaining, though it is not covered.  The home&#8217;s siding looks like it might be asbestos (though I am not an expert in this field), and the roof appears to be in good condition&mdash;probably less than ten years old.<\/p>\n<p>Last time this house was sold (April 2005) it went pending in three days and sold for $42,250 over the asking price, closing at $431,200.
